Postby Lowie » Thu Nov 13, 2008 12:23 am

what difference does the carbon brace (steering) make, Ed?

Also, I noticed you used the One-way in your first set-ups, but switched to Spool for all the others.
Why did you do so, if I may ask
doesn't the 416 perform well with the One-way?
Lowie
D Finalist
D Finalist
 
Posts: 33
Joined: Tue Sep 02, 2008 10:15 pm

Re: Ed Clark

Postby TryHard » Thu Nov 13, 2008 9:53 am

The carbon steering brace just seems to help make the front of the car a bit smoother, and gives a little more grip.

As for the Spool, it's related to the motor class, and alos the track conditions. IMO, 13.5 brushless (which is faster than 27t) is about the limit for a one-way in terms of whats the faster way for getting round the track, at least in the hands of us mortals anyway :p
I came close to trying one in the car at the weekend, but in the end figured there was no need as I could gain steering on the car another way. 10.5t and higher I would use a spool regardless, if running 17.5/27t then a one-way is probably the way to go, unless the track is very tight and twisty, when I would look towards a diff.
